linux命令编辑文件命令是什么
-
Linux命令编辑文件的主要命令是vi和nano。下面分别对这两个命令进行介绍。
1. vi命令:vi是Linux系统中最常用的文本编辑器之一。它具有强大的编辑功能和灵活的操作方式。
vi命令的基本格式是:vi filename
使用vi命令编辑文件的基本步骤如下:
1)打开要编辑的文件:可以直接输入文件名来打开已存在的文件,如果文件不存在,则会新建一个空文件。
2)进入编辑模式:按下键盘上的i键,进入插入模式,此时可以直接编辑文件内容。
3)编辑文件内容:在插入模式下,可以进行文本的插入、删除、修改等操作。
4)保存文件并退出编辑模式:按下键盘上的Esc键,退出插入模式,然后输入冒号(:)并按下键盘上的wq键,保存文件并退出编辑器。2. nano命令:nano是一个简单易用的文本编辑器,在某些版本的Linux系统中,nano可能已经预装了,无需单独安装。
nano命令的基本格式是:nano filename
使用nano命令编辑文件的基本步骤如下:
1)打开要编辑的文件:可以直接输入文件名来打开已存在的文件,如果文件不存在,则会新建一个空文件。
2)进入编辑模式:可以直接在编辑器中输入文本。
3)编辑文件内容:在编辑模式下,可以进行文本的插入、删除、修改等操作。
4)保存文件并退出编辑模式:按下键盘上的Ctrl+O组合键,保存文件;然后按下键盘上的Ctrl+X组合键,退出编辑器。以上就是编辑文件的两个常用的Linux命令vi和nano的简单介绍和基本使用方法。
2年前 -
在Linux系统中,有多种命令可以用来编辑文件。以下是几种常用的Linux命令编辑文件的方法:
1. Vim: Vim是Linux系统上最常用的文本编辑器之一。可以使用以下命令编辑文件:
“`
vim filename
“`
这个命令会打开一个Vim编辑器,可以在其中编辑文件。在Vim中,可以使用各种命令来编辑文件,如插入、删除、复制、粘贴、搜索等等。2. Nano: Nano是一个简单易用的文本编辑器,在终端中使用以下命令可以打开文件并进行编辑:
“`
nano filename
“`
这将会在Nano编辑器中打开指定的文件,可以使用键盘上的各种命令来编辑文件。3. Emacs: Emacs是另一个功能强大的文本编辑器,可以使用以下命令来编辑文件:
“`
emacs filename
“`
这将会打开Emacs编辑器,并在其中打开指定的文件。Emacs也有大量的快捷键和命令可以用来编辑文件。4. SED命令:SED是一个非交互式的流式文本编辑器,可以使用以下命令对文件进行编辑:
“`
sed -i ‘s/old_string/new_string/g’ filename
“`
这个命令将会在文件中查找指定的字符串,并将其替换为新的字符串。-i选项指定直接修改文件。5. AWK命令:AWK是一个功能强大的文本处理工具,可以用来编辑文件,如提取特定的行或列。以下是一个使用AWK命令编辑文件的示例:
“`
awk ‘{ print $1 }’ filename
“`
这个命令将会打印文件的第一列内容到终端。这些是常用的几种Linux命令去编辑文件的方法,每一种都有其特点和用途,可以根据具体情况选择使用。
2年前 -
在Linux操作系统中,有多个命令可以用于编辑文件。其中最常用的几个命令有:
1. vi:vi是Linux系统中最经典的文本编辑器之一。它可以用来编辑任何类型的文本文件,包括配置文件和程序代码等。在终端中输入`vi 文件名`即可打开文件,并进入vi编辑器界面。
2. nano:nano是一款简单易用的文本编辑器,适合初学者使用。它具有简单的操作界面和常用编辑功能,例如复制、粘贴、查找、替换等。在终端中输入`nano 文件名`即可打开文件,并进入nano编辑器界面。
3. emacs:emacs是一款功能丰富的文本编辑器,拥有众多的扩展功能和编辑命令。但是由于其复杂的操作方式和学习曲线较陡,一般更适合有经验的用户使用。在终端中输入`emacs 文件名`即可打开文件,并进入emacs编辑器界面。
无论使用哪种编辑器,都可以通过简单的命令实现文件的编辑操作。例如,插入文本、删除文本、保存修改等。这些命令在每个编辑器中略有不同,需要根据具体的编辑器进行学习和使用。
需要注意的是,在使用vi、nano和emacs编辑器时,如果要对文件进行保存并退出,可以使用以下命令:
– 在vi编辑器中,按下`Esc`键,然后输入`:wq`后按下`Enter`键;
– 在nano编辑器中,按下`Ctrl + O`键,然后按下`Enter`键,最后按下`Ctrl + X`键;
– 在emacs编辑器中,按下`Ctrl + X`键,然后按下`Ctrl + S`键保存文件,按下`Ctrl + X`键,然后按下`Ctrl + C`键退出编辑器。此外,还有其他一些命令行编辑器,如sed、awk等,用于特定的文本处理需求,可根据实际情况选择使用。
2年前